The Kryptonite Keeper 785 is a 33.5-inch heavy-duty bike chain lock crafted from 7mm hardened manganese steel with four-sided links for maximum cut resistance. It features a patented end link design and a pick- and drill-resistant disc-style cylinder for enhanced security. A weather-resistant nylon sleeve and rubber coating protect your bike from scratches. Weighing 3.1 pounds, it includes two ergonomic keys and qualifies for Kryptonite’s Anti-Theft Protection Offer and KeySafe program, all backed by a limited lifetime warranty.

The Best Budget Lock! (Especially for Students)
My experience:I recently got a new electric scooter, and decided to get a lock with it to replace my old U-Lock from Masterlock. I must say that this Kryptonite chain lock is insanely well-built! I am not a fanatic in locks, but I can definitely tell that this is a great quality lock, and I have had no issues with being able to lock my scooter anywhere with it.Pros:The lock is very versatile. The chain design makes it extremely easy to lock and ensures that thieves have trouble cutting it open, especially if you make well-designed loops around areas around the scooter that are very hard to physically access hands-on. The lock comes with a spare key and it is relatively light for a metal chain, weighing around 5 pounds or so. I bought this lock for around $40, and I must say it is definitely a great budget lock, especially for students who have just bought a new e-bike or scooter and are afraid of thieves!Cons:The lock isn’t the most portable compared to a U-Lock. For U-locks, you can easily hook onto a bike or scooter while riding; however, chain locks are a lot different in that case and require you to at least have a backpack or bag on the handlebars as you ride. This could be difficult for some people, but as a student it's perfect for me since I always carry my backpack everywhere!Another con is definitely the length of the chain, which gives some limitations when trying to lock it around areas that you may find more secure. It is only 2.5 feet, so if you have enough money, I highly recommend spending for the extra length. Just remember to have the portability to carry it!Verdict:This lock is great, and I highly recommend it if you’re on a budget. If you are someone who is still skeptical, you can always invest in another Kryptonite lock or possibly just buy one of these variants with a longer chain capability. I lock it around my school every day and have no hassle with taking it in and out. Remember to always lock your belongings, especially your e-vehicles!

Excellent lock.
Yes, it weighs a bit, but if you have a small enough waistline (mine is 28in, the chain is 32in), then you can transport it that way, or wrap it around your seatpost (this is the way I carry mine). Honestly it doesn't weigh much more than my U-Lock though. Anyway, I live in LA and this is great for when you need to make a few stops and leave your bike for a couple hours or so. At night, I store my bike in my home, so I don't worry about having to leave it out overnight. But I have been to more sketchy areas and left my bike locked with this lock, and I can say that as long as you know what you are doing, you will be fine with this lock. I make sure to wrap it through my frame and wheel and then tie it before actually locking it.As far as locking and unlocking, honestly it's not that hard. I saw others complaining that their keys get stuck, etc etc. It says right there on the little attention label attached with the keys that you need to make sure the key is inserted to the bottom of the cylinder before turning it. Nothing too complicated about that. I was able to get in and out of the lock with no issues. If it tends to get stuck, you could also probably put a drop of lube in it and it should be fine. That's what I do to my older U-lock (that I also use in conjunction with this lock for my back tire.I feel so much more comfortable locking my bike and leaving it to shop or do whatever I'm going to do. I don't get any sense that my bike is going to be gone when I get back. I do see other people with much nicer-looking bikes who do really poor jobs at locking them up, and it saddens me, because I know that if a thief had to choose between my bike and that person's, they'd choose theirs based on how poorly it's secured. Kryptonite has really good information on their site about locking and securing your bike. Not to mention, they will even suggest what type of lock(s) you should get based on the type of area you live in, things like that. There is so much good information out there on YouTube and places like that.Obviously if a person really wants your bike, they will get it no matter what, but you can do your part to make it as difficult as possible. Put up a good fight.Speaking of fights, this chain also makes very good weapon too, if someone were trying to walk up on you in a dodgy part of town, you could definitely whack'em with this. It's that sturdy and heavy.Overall, 5 out of 5 stars. Great lock for the price, and for where I live and tend to go. Wouldn't recommend this one if you live some place like San Francisco or NY though (depending what part). At least not without a second lock of choice. But in most parts of Los Angeles (except maybe Santa Monica or North Hollywood, HUGE theft target areas) with this lock and proper locking technique, you should be fine.
